Although the hotel recently expanded to offer 73 rooms and suites, it hasn’t lost its boutique charm, and the homely touches make it a good place to avoid the crowds of nearby resorts.

With rooms giving onto serene gardens, and the Victoria Falls just a short walk away, the location and setting are hard to beat.

The Palm Restaurant is one of the best places to eat around Victoria Falls, and offers contemporary cuisine with views of the spray from the lovely terrace.

Surrounding area

Ilala enjoys the perfect location, set right on the edge of Victoria Falls Town while offering easy access to restaurants and shops at nearby malls. It’s also the last hotel on the road to the Falls, which are an easy 10-minute walk downhill.

Though the location is central, the lush gardens of the hotel ensure there’s no shortage of peace and quiet. Aside from the constant roar from the ‘smoke that thunders’, of course.

White-water rafting on the Zambezi River

Zimbabwe[1.4 miles]

Take courage in both hands and raft the world-class white-water rapids of the mighty, crocodile-infested Zambezi River, funneling through the Batoka Gorge at Victoria Falls. And remember to look out for the crocs!

Best for ages: 15+ | £100 | 5-10 hours

Swim in the Devil’s Pool

Livingstone, Southern Province, Zambia[1.4 miles]

This small island in the centre of the flow offers a mind-blowing picnic spot – right on the edge of the 103m-high Falls. A lucky (crazy) few can sign up for a dip in the small lagoon sitting right on the lip.

Best for ages: 12+ | £115 | 2 hours

Afternoon tea at the Victoria Falls Hotel

Victoria Falls Town, Matabeleland North, Central African Republic (CAR)[0.5 miles]

Dating back to 1904, The Victoria Falls Hotel occupies a dramatic promontory above the Batoka Gorge. It’s a view best enjoyed over the decadent platters served for afternoon tea, a much-loved tradition.

Best for ages: 13+ | £15 | 1-2 hours

Golf at Elephant Hills

Victoria Falls Town, Matabeleland North, Zimbabwe[2.3 miles]

Designed by golfing legend Gary Player, the 18-hole Elephant Hills course upstream from the Falls is one of the wildest golf courses in Africa, and players will have to mind the antelope and crocodiles as carefully as the water hazards.

Best for ages: 13+ | £10 | 2-4 hours
